it looks alright.

get a tupperware container...riddle the sides and lid with holes so flow can get through and put a bunch of rubble in it. put the shroom in and wait until it attaches to soemthing on its own. This can take a couple fo days for florida rics but yumas can take weeks. wait until it is attached well before removing then you can either glue the rubble it attached to to soemthing else or just put it in the sand somewhere as is.
